400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么打不开隐藏文件

作者:路由通
|
215人看过
发布时间:2026-03-21 23:09:37
标签:
当您尝试在电子表格软件中打开一个被标记为“隐藏”的文件时,可能会遇到操作失败的情况。这并非简单的软件故障,而是涉及文件属性、系统权限、软件设置乃至文件自身完整性的一个多层次问题。本文将深入剖析这一现象背后的十二个关键原因,从基础的系统文件属性设置,到软件的安全防护机制,再到复杂的文件关联与路径问题,为您提供一套完整的排查与解决方案,帮助您高效恢复对隐藏数据文件的访问。
excel为什么打不开隐藏文件

       在日常使用电子表格软件处理数据时,我们偶尔会遇到一个令人困惑的情况:一个明明存在的文件,软件却提示无法打开,尤其是当这个文件被设置了“隐藏”属性后。许多用户的第一反应是文件损坏或软件出了问题,但实际情况往往更为复杂。无法打开隐藏文件这一现象,就像一扇紧闭的门,背后有多把不同的锁。要打开它,我们需要找到正确的钥匙。本文将系统性地拆解这扇门背后的多重锁具,即导致电子表格软件无法打开隐藏文件的十几个核心原因,并提供相应的解锁方法。

       一、 最直接的障碍:操作系统级别的文件隐藏属性

       这是最表层也是最常见的原因。在视窗操作系统中,文件除了其内容本身,还附带了一系列属性,其中“隐藏”就是一项。当文件被标记为隐藏后,在默认的文件资源管理器设置下,它将不会显示在常规的文件夹视图中。电子表格软件在通过“文件”菜单中的“打开”对话框浏览文件时,其底层调用的是操作系统的文件浏览接口。如果系统设置为“不显示隐藏的文件、文件夹或驱动器”,那么该接口自然也无法“看到”这个隐藏文件,从而导致用户在对话框中根本找不到它,更谈不上打开。解决方案是临时更改文件夹选项,勾选“显示隐藏的文件、文件夹和驱动器”,使文件可见。

       二、 软件自身的视图过滤机制

       除了依赖系统接口,高版本的电子表格软件自身也可能内置了文件视图过滤器。在“打开”对话框的右下角,通常有一个文件类型下拉筛选菜单,默认可能设置为“所有电子表格文件”或“所有文件”。但有时,这个过滤器可能被意外修改或受到某些设置影响,自动过滤掉了隐藏文件。即便系统层面已经显示了隐藏文件,软件自身的这个过滤器也可能将其排除在外。确保在下拉菜单中选择“所有文件”,是排除此问题的关键一步。

       三、 文件路径的深度与权限嵌套

       隐藏文件有时并非单独存在,它可能位于一个隐藏的文件夹内,或者文件夹的路径非常深,包含特殊字符或过长的名称。操作系统和应用程序对文件路径的长度和字符类型都有限制。当路径超过一定字符数(例如,视窗操作系统的最大路径长度限制),或包含不被支持的字符时,即使文件可见,软件也可能无法正确解析其位置,导致打开失败。此外,如果隐藏文件所在的整个目录结构权限设置复杂,当前登录的用户账户可能没有足够的读取权限,访问也会被拒绝。

       四、 文件关联与默认程序设置错误

       电子表格文件(通常以.xlsx、.xls等为后缀)需要与电子表格软件正确关联,双击时才能由该软件打开。如果这个关联被其他程序(例如,文本编辑器或别的办公软件)篡改,或者关联设置损坏,那么当您尝试直接双击隐藏的电子表格文件时,系统可能会调用错误的程序来打开,自然会导致失败或乱码。您需要在操作系统的“默认应用”设置中,确保电子表格文件类型与正确的软件关联。

       五、 软件的安全防护与受信任位置设置

       现代电子表格软件出于安全考虑,内置了强大的防护机制。其中一个机制是限制从“不受信任”的位置打开文件,特别是那些可能包含宏代码的文件。如果隐藏文件存放在一个未被软件标记为“受信任位置”的目录(如临时文件夹或网络驱动器),软件可能会主动阻止打开,并弹出安全警告。您需要检查软件的“信任中心”设置,将文件所在目录添加为受信任位置,或者临时调整宏安全设置(需谨慎操作)。

       六、 文件扩展名被双重隐藏

       一个容易被忽略的情况是,在操作系统设置中,有一项“隐藏已知文件类型的扩展名”。如果此选项被启用,同时文件又被手动添加了错误的扩展名(例如,一个文本文件被重命名为“报告.xlsx”),那么它显示出来的只是一个名为“报告”的电子表格图标文件,但其真实内容并非电子表格格式。当您试图用电子表格软件打开它时,软件会按照扩展名指示去解析内容,发现格式不符,从而报错。确保显示文件扩展名,并核对其正确性,至关重要。

       七、 临时文件与锁定状态冲突

       电子表格软件在打开文件时,通常会在同一目录下生成一个临时的、隐藏的锁定文件(文件名可能以波浪符“~$”开头),用以标识该文件正在被使用,防止多人同时编辑造成冲突。如果软件非正常关闭(如崩溃或强制结束进程),这个隐藏的锁定文件可能没有被正确删除。当您再次尝试打开原文件时,软件检测到残留的锁定文件,可能会误认为文件已被占用,从而拒绝访问。手动删除这个隐藏的锁定文件即可解决问题。

       八、 文件系统错误与磁盘坏道

       存储文件的硬盘或分区如果存在文件系统错误或物理坏道,可能会导致文件索引信息损坏。对于隐藏文件,其属性信息也是存储在文件系统索引中的。一旦这部分索引损坏,操作系统可能无法准确定位和读取文件,即使取消了隐藏属性也无济于事。此时,可以尝试使用操作系统的磁盘检查工具来扫描并修复驱动器错误。

       九、 防病毒软件的实时扫描干扰

       防病毒软件为了监控恶意行为,会对应用程序访问文件的操作进行实时扫描。当电子表格软件试图打开一个隐藏文件时,这个访问行为可能会被防病毒软件拦截并深入分析。如果扫描过程耗时过长,或者防病毒软件误将此行为判定为可疑而加以阻止,就会导致打开操作超时或直接失败。临时禁用防病毒软件的实时保护功能(操作后请记得重新开启),或将其添加到防病毒软件的排除列表,可以验证是否为此问题。

       十、 文件内容加密与密码保护

       文件可能同时具备“隐藏”属性和“加密”或“密码保护”属性。通过操作系统的文件加密功能或电子表格软件自身的“用密码进行加密”功能,可以对文件内容进行保护。在这种情况下,取消隐藏属性只是让文件可见,但要打开它,还必须提供正确的密码或用于解密的用户证书。如果忘记了密码或没有相应的证书,文件将无法被访问。这属于一种主动的安全设置,而非故障。

       十一、 软件版本兼容性与文件格式过时

       隐藏文件可能是一个使用旧版本电子表格软件(如非常古老的版本)创建的文件,其内部格式与当前使用的新版本软件不完全兼容。虽然新版本软件通常支持打开旧格式文件,但在某些极端情况下,特别是文件本身已部分损坏时,兼容性层可能无法正确处理。此外,如果文件是来自其他办公软件(如开源办公套件)并保存为兼容格式,也可能出现解析差异。尝试使用文件最初创建的软件版本打开,或将其导入新版软件,是可行的思路。

       十二、 系统资源不足或软件组件损坏

       在极少数情况下,打开文件失败可能与文件是否隐藏无关,而是由于更深层的系统问题。例如,计算机内存或系统资源严重不足,导致软件没有足够资源加载文件。更可能的是,电子表格软件本身的某些核心组件或动态链接库文件损坏、丢失或版本冲突,影响了其正常的文件打开功能。此时,修复或重新安装办公软件套件,往往能解决根本问题。

       十三、 网络驱动器与脱机文件的同步问题

       如果隐藏文件存储在网络驱动器(如公司内部的文件服务器或云存储同步文件夹)上,打开失败可能与网络连接状态和同步策略有关。某些同步客户端会将文件设置为“仅在线可用”或“脱机可用”,如果网络断开且文件未被同步到本地,访问就会失败。同时,网络权限比本地权限更为复杂,即使文件可见,也可能因为网络访问控制列表的限制而无法读取。

       十四、 注册表键值异常影响文件打开逻辑

       在视窗操作系统中,文件类型的打开方式、图标、上下文菜单等都由注册表中的相关键值控制。如果与电子表格文件关联的注册表项出现错误、被恶意软件篡改或损坏,可能会扰乱软件打开文件的正常流程。这种影响是全局性的,不仅限于隐藏文件,但隐藏文件由于属性特殊,有时会首先暴露出问题。使用系统工具或专业软件修复注册表关联,可能有助于解决。

       十五、 宏安全设置对隐藏文件的特殊限制

       对于启用了宏的电子表格文件,软件的安全策略更为严格。如前所述,软件可能阻止打开来自非受信任位置的宏文件。此外,一些企业级的管理策略可能会通过组策略对象,特别限制对隐藏的、包含宏的文件进行访问,以防止员工无意中运行潜在的恶意代码。这需要检查并调整宏安全级别,或在必要时联系系统管理员。

       十六、 尝试通过命令行或脚本打开时的路径引用

       高级用户或自动化脚本可能会通过命令行参数来启动电子表格软件并打开指定文件。如果在脚本或命令中,文件路径没有正确引用(例如,路径中包含空格但未用引号括起来),或者指定的路径是相对路径而非绝对路径,而当前工作目录并非文件所在目录,那么打开操作就会失败。确保在脚本中使用完整、正确的绝对路径,并妥善处理特殊字符。

       十七、 文件头信息损坏导致格式识别失败

       每一个电子表格文件在二进制层面都有一个“文件头”,其中包含了关于文件格式、版本等关键元数据。软件依靠读取文件头来判断这是否是一个有效的、自己能处理的文件。如果文件因存储介质问题、传输错误或保存过程中断而导致文件头几个字节的数据损坏,软件就会无法识别其格式,直接判定为无法打开的文件。使用专业的文件修复工具,或者尝试从备份中恢复,是最后的希望。

       十八、 用户配置文件损坏影响软件运行状态

       最后,问题可能出在用户层面。电子表格软件会为每个用户创建独立的配置文件,存储个性化设置和临时状态。如果这个配置文件损坏,可能会导致软件出现各种异常行为,包括无法正常打开特定类型或特定属性的文件。创建一个新的操作系统用户账户并测试,或者重置电子表格软件的用户设置(通常可以通过在启动时按住特定键实现),可以判断问题是否源于此。

       综上所述,电子表格软件无法打开隐藏文件,绝非一个孤立的、单一原因导致的问题。它是一个从操作系统外壳到软件内核,从文件存储到安全策略,从用户权限到系统状态的综合性故障现象。在遇到此类问题时,建议用户按照从简到繁、从外到内的顺序进行排查:首先确认文件是否在系统中可见,其次检查软件设置和文件路径,再次审视安全软件和权限配置,最后考虑文件自身完整性和系统环境健康度。通过这种系统性的诊断方法,绝大多数“打不开”的困境都能迎刃而解,让您重新掌控那些隐藏在角落里的宝贵数据。

相关文章
excel计算不了是什么情况
当您遇到电子表格软件(Excel)无法进行计算的情况时,这可能由多种复杂因素导致。从看似简单的单元格格式设置错误、公式语法问题,到更深层次的软件设置冲突、文件损坏或系统资源不足,每一个环节都可能成为计算的障碍。本文将系统性地剖析十二个核心原因,并提供经过验证的解决方案,帮助您从根本上诊断并修复问题,恢复数据处理的高效与准确。
2026-03-21 23:09:21
334人看过
为什么excel数字后边都是零
在处理电子表格时,许多用户都曾遇到一个令人困惑的现象:输入的数字后边莫名出现多个零。这通常并非数据错误,而是由单元格格式、数据类型或软件显示设置等多种因素共同导致的结果。理解其背后的原理,不仅能有效解决显示问题,更能提升数据处理的规范性与效率。本文将系统剖析这一常见现象背后的十二个关键原因,并提供实用的解决方案。
2026-03-21 23:09:19
170人看过
excel中什么是联合运算符
联合运算符是微软表格处理软件中用于连接多个单元格区域或引用范围的符号,通常体现为逗号字符。该运算符能够将不同区域组合成单一引用,广泛应用于函数参数传递、数据汇总及多区域分析等场景。理解其工作原理能显著提升数据处理效率,是掌握进阶表格操作技巧的关键环节。
2026-03-21 23:09:18
392人看过
excel为什么总是损坏格式化
在日常工作中,电子表格文件意外损坏或格式丢失是许多用户面临的棘手问题。本文将深入剖析其背后的十二大核心原因,涵盖文件结构、存储环境、软件兼容性及操作习惯等多个维度。文章结合官方技术资料,提供从预防到修复的详尽解决方案,旨在帮助用户系统性地理解问题本质,掌握保护数据完整性的实用技巧,从而有效提升工作效率与数据安全。
2026-03-21 23:09:18
46人看过
EXCEL中求工龄是用什么公式
在计算员工工龄时,Excel提供了多种强大的函数与公式组合,能够精准应对不同需求。本文将系统性地剖析工龄计算的十二种核心方法,涵盖从基础的日期差计算到处理复杂人事规则的进阶技巧,并结合实例详解常用函数如日期差函数、取整函数、文本函数的应用场景与注意事项,助您高效完成人事数据统计与分析工作。
2026-03-21 23:08:38
402人看过
为什么word2010的光标乱动
在撰写或编辑文档时,光标突然不受控制地跳跃、闪烁或自行移动,是许多微软Word 2010用户曾遭遇的棘手问题。这不仅打断了工作流程,还可能引发数据丢失的风险。本文将深入剖析导致光标乱动的十二个核心原因,涵盖从硬件设备干扰、软件设置冲突到系统兼容性等多个层面。我们将依据官方技术文档和权威分析,提供一系列经过验证的解决方案,帮助您彻底根治这一顽疾,恢复顺畅的文档操作体验。
2026-03-21 23:07:50
288人看过